Ext2Read (also known as Ext2Explore) is a free, open-source file system driver that allows Windows to read from Linux ext2/ext3/ext4 file systems. It enables Windows users to access files stored on Linux partitions or external drives without having to dual boot or use virtualization software.

WinFsp is an open-source Windows File System Proxy that provides user-space file systems for Windows. It allows developers to quickly build high-performance file systems without writing kernel code.
